About Oakwood Academy
Oakwood Academy is an Seventh-day Adventist private elementary school in Taylor, MI 48180. The school serves approximately 29 students in grades Kindergarten – 8th with a student-teacher ratio of 14.5:1. Located in a neighborhood with a median household income of $59,537, where 16%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her.
The school is situated in a small city setting.
What Parents Should Know
With an enrollment of 29 students, Oakwood Academy is a smaller school where families often find a close-knit community atmosphere. Smaller settings can mean more individual attention from teachers and staff, though they may offer fewer extracurricular options than larger schools.
As a private school, Oakwood Academy operates independently from the local public school district. Families considering this school should inquire about tuition costs, financial aid availability, and the admissions process. Private schools are not required to follow the same curriculum standards as public schools, which can be either an advantage or a consideration depending on your priorities.

Why doesn't this school have a score?
We don't have enough verified data to rate this school fairly. Private schools in MI aren't required to report standardized test scores to the state, which limits the data available for our rating model.
Our rating model requires at least 2 of 3 data components (academics, student progress, college readiness, and resources) to generate a meaningful score. Schools below this threshold receive a Limited Profile to avoid misleading ratings.
